Superior Structure & Stable Measurement
Equipped with a standard three-electrode oil cup (2mm gap), it effectively eliminates interference from stray capacitance and leakage current, ensuring high repeatability and reliability. The built-in standard capacitor maintains stable capacitance and loss values unaffected by ambient temperature and humidity, enabling long-term high-precision testing.
-
Efficient & Safe Heating System
Using medium-frequency induction heating, the instrument provides non-contact, uniform and rapid heating with precise control up to 120℃. Multiple safety protections - including high-voltage cut-off when the cover is opened and electrode short-circuit alerts - fully protect operators and equipment.
Key Technical Specifications
Test voltage: AC 0–2000V, DC 0–500V
Temperature range: Ambient to 120℃
Dielectric loss factor: 0.00001–100
Volume resistivity: 2.5 MΩ·m – 100 TΩ·m
Relative permittivity: 0–40
Data storage: 100 groups with real-time clock
Dimensions: 470 mm × 425 mm × 385 mm
Net weight: 22 kg
Operating environment: 0℃–40℃, humidity ≤75%RH
